#de3bd8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#de3bd8 is composed of 87.1% red, 23.1% green and 84.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 73.4% magenta, 2.7%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 302.2 degrees, a saturation of 71.2% and a lightness of 55.1%. #de3bd8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ff76ff with #bd00b1.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

#de3bd8 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#de3bd8 has RGB values of R:222, G:59, B:216 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.73, Y:0.03,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14564312.

Hex triplet de3bd8 #de3bd8
RGB Decimal 222, 59, 216 rgb(222,59,216)
RGB Percent 87.1, 23.1, 84.7 rgb(87.1%,23.1%,84.7%)
CMYK 0, 73, 3, 13
HSL 302.2°, 71.2, 55.1 hsl(302.2,71.2%,55.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 302.2°, 73.4, 87.1
Web Safe cc33cc #cc33cc
CIE-LAB 55.704, 77.963, -46.653
XYZ 44.082, 23.618, 67.199
xyY 0.327, 0.175, 23.618
CIE-LCH 55.704, 90.855, 329.103
CIE-LUV 55.704, 69.564, -82.578
Hunter-Lab 48.599, 76.863, -47.963
Binary 11011110, 00111011, 11011000

Shades and Tints of #de3bd8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050105 is the darkest color, while #fdf4f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#de3bd8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8f8a8f is the less saturated color, while #f821f0 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#de3bd8 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#7e7e7e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#917190 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#3a87ff Protanopia 1% of men
  • #6e8bc8 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#d36b72 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#756bf0 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#966ece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#d75a97 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
